消息追踪之rabbitmq_tracing rabbitmq_tracing 一、命令 1、启动命令 rabbitmq-plugins disable rabbitmq_tracing [root@i-rovnykap default]# ./sbin ...
转 在使用rabbitmq时,我们有时需要查看消息队列生产 消费了那些消息,便于我们排错。rabbitmq中提供一个插件rabbitmq tracing用于记录消息的日志,默认是未打开的,需要自己用命令打开 查看打开的插件 前面带e rabbitmq plugins list 开启rabbitmq的tracing插件 rabbitmq plugins enable rabbitmq tracin ...
2021-12-27 09:20 0 1632 推荐指数:
消息追踪之rabbitmq_tracing rabbitmq_tracing 一、命令 1、启动命令 rabbitmq-plugins disable rabbitmq_tracing [root@i-rovnykap default]# ./sbin ...
消息队列无法被消费,必须重启应用才能正常消费 二、现网应用包参考 rabbitmq3.6.6 ra ...
一个关于客户端(消费者)开启自动应答,重启后"未处理消息丢失"的小坑。(主要是对RabbitMQ理解不够) 首先,申明一下: 本文所谓的 "丢失消息" 不是指服务器宕机、重启等原因导致内存中消息丢失,也就是说不是关于消息持久化的问题。 使用C# 编写测试。 问题表象: 消费 ...
一 重复消息 为什么会出现消息重复?消息重复的原因有两个:1.生产时消息重复,2.消费时消息重复。 1.1 生产时消息重复 由于生产者发送消息给MQ,在MQ确认的时候出现了网络波动,生产者没有收到确认,实际上MQ已经接收到了消息。这时候生产者就会重新发送一遍这条消息。 生产者中如果消息未被 ...
1)生产者弄丢了数据 生产者将数据发送到rabbitmq的时候,可能因为网络问题导致数据就在半路给搞丢了。 1.可以选择用rabbitmq提供的事务功能,在生产者发送数据之前开启rabbitmq事务(channel.txSelect),然后发送消息,如果消息没有成 ...
转载请注明出处 0.目录 RabbitMQ-从基础到实战(1)— Hello RabbitMQ RabbitMQ-从基础到实战(2)— 防止消息丢失 RabbitMQ-从基础到实战(3)— 消息的交换(上) RabbitMQ-从基础到实战(4)— 消息的交换(中) RabbitMQ- ...
RabbitMQ 之消息确认机制(事务+Confirm) https://blog.csdn.net/u013256816/article/details/55515234 概述: 在 Rabbitmq 中我们可以通过持久化来解决因为服务器异常而导致丢失的问题 ...
转载请注明出处 0.目录 RabbitMQ-从基础到实战(1)— Hello RabbitMQ RabbitMQ-从基础到实战(2)— 防止消息丢失 RabbitMQ-从基础到实战(4)— 消息的交换(中) RabbitMQ-从基础到实战(5)— 消息的交换(下) RabbitMQ- ...